Why Chefs Should Wear a Coat

There are actually a lot of reasons why one should wear a chef jacket or a chef coats. The chef jacket has indeed gone through a tremendous evolution in terms of its functionality, durability and comfort. It is this combination of characteristics that makes it the uniform of choice for professional chefs around the world, not to mention the fact that it looks really cool.

Functionality - One of the main and most important function of the chef coat is to safeguard the chef from the extreme heat produced from the stove or oven,and also from any accidental spills of hot liquids. It is able to perform this function through the help of the double layer of cotton. In addition, aside from this protective function of the chef jacket, it also is able to protect the wearer, or the chef for this matter, from any splashes and stains that are associated in the preparation of food.

You might wonder why persons with such a tendency to get their uniform stained and splattered would wear white. This practice originally started in the mid 1800's by a chef named Chef Marie - Antoine Careme, who started the practice of wearing white and letting her cooks also wear white as it symbolizes cleanliness.

The double breasted style of the Chef Coat, also came into favor at this time (also due to Careme).  Chef jackets are always expected to become stained after cooking because its main function is to protect the chef from stains and spills. Aside from food preparation, the chefs also will need to leave the kitchen to talk with guests, and for this, the chef can easily reverse the jacket to reveal the cleaner side.

Durability - Because the black chef coat is made out of two layers of cotton fabric, the jacket is highly durable. One very important quality of the chef jacket is that it should be able to withstand the frequent extreme activities that are done in the kitchen, and also, it has to be able to stand up despite frequent washings. Not only is the jacket itself highly durable, but the buttons are also constructed of knotted cloth, making them just as durable.

Comfort - One may think that the double breasted jacket is not a very smart thing to wear in areas like the kitchen. But then, the unique construction of the double- breasted jacket shows its distinctive versatility. Cotton is a very breathable and comfortable fabric, which makes it a superior choice in hot environments.
